Output 81c272186230546bc17f4451fd59f5a105499f88a7af548115210473d0f701f3:0

value
8368489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49ee2d85beaa69527b06384cdae314236fe672e6 OP_EQUALVERIFY OP_CHECKSIG
address
17juetYyrf4MuxanTxraKAzDtM11PxigHb
transaction
81c272186230546bc17f4451fd59f5a105499f88a7af548115210473d0f701f3
spent
true